Mardle Meaning: Unraveling the Roots of a Unique Surname

The surname Mardle, although uncommon, carries with it a rich history and fascinating etymology. Its origins can be traced back to an English village called Mardale Green in Westmoreland, first documented in the Feet of Fines of 1278 as "Merdale." The name is derived from the Old English words "mere," meaning "sea," and "dael," meaning "valley" or "dale."

During the medieval period, as people began to move further afield, it became common practice to adopt the name of their place of origin as a means of identification, leading to the widespread distribution of the name. Examples of the evolution of the surname can be seen in records such as Daniel Mardoll in 1637 in St Mary's, Whitechapel, Stepney, and Joseph Mardale in 1795 in St. Nicholas, Liverpool, Lancashire.

The earliest recorded instance of the name dates back to John Mardell, who married Agnes Morland on July 18, 1591, in Brough under Stainmore, Westmoreland, during the reign of Queen Elizabeth I, also known as "Good Queen Bess" (1558-1603). Family names became necessary as governments introduced individual taxation, such as the Poll Tax in England. Over the centuries, surnames have continued to "evolve" in all countries, often resulting in remarkable variations from their original spelling.
